Requirement schedule for Padstow

A workable requirement schedule record should convert the buyer's needs into answerable tender items. For Padstow commercial cleaning contractor, the supporting details include escalation steps, defined task schedules and the authorised response to unclear specifications. The schedule gives every supplier the same starting requirement. This gives the buyer a specific decision to approve instead of a broad service promise.

Scope comparison for Padstow

The Padstow assessor documents scope comparison by making the service record compare included tasks, intervals and exclusions line by line. The evidence is drawn from service frequencies, defined task schedules and the confirmed effect of supplier accountability gaps on commercial cleaning contractor. The comparison exposes differences hidden by broad service labels. Any assumption connected to retail remains subject to the premises walkthrough.
